public class EventGenerator extends Object
Constructor and Description |
---|
EventGenerator() |
Modifier and Type | Method and Description |
---|---|
void |
addEventGeneratedListener(IEventGeneratedListener l) |
protected void |
fireEventGenerated(Event event) |
Event |
generateEvent(String eventType,
int procId,
ITask task,
long date,
Map<String,Long> metrics) |
Event |
generateEvent(String eventType,
ITask task,
long date,
Map<String,Long> metrics) |
static List<String> |
getAvailableEvents() |
Event |
getNewInstance(String eventType,
ITask task,
int procId,
long date,
Map<String,Long> metrics) |
Event |
getNewInstance(String eventType,
ITask task,
long date,
Map<String,Long> metrics) |
void |
removeEventGeneratedListener(IEventGeneratedListener l) |
public void addEventGeneratedListener(IEventGeneratedListener l)
public void removeEventGeneratedListener(IEventGeneratedListener l)
protected void fireEventGenerated(Event event)
public Event getNewInstance(String eventType, ITask task, int procId, long date, Map<String,Long> metrics)
public Event getNewInstance(String eventType, ITask task, long date, Map<String,Long> metrics)
public Event generateEvent(String eventType, int procId, ITask task, long date, Map<String,Long> metrics)
public Event generateEvent(String eventType, ITask task, long date, Map<String,Long> metrics)
Copyright © 2012. All Rights Reserved.